微信小程序自2017年上線以來,迅速成為移動應(yīng)用開發(fā)的重要平臺之一。對于想要涉足小程序開發(fā)的開發(fā)者來說,掌握官方提供的教程是入門和進(jìn)階的關(guān)鍵。以下是對微信官方小程序開發(fā)教程的簡要概述,旨在幫助開發(fā)者快速上手。
一、環(huán)境搭建
首先,開發(fā)者需要在電腦上安裝Node.js環(huán)境,這是運行微信開發(fā)者工具的前提。接著,通過微信開發(fā)者工具官網(wǎng)下載并安裝微信開發(fā)者工具。此工具集成了代碼編輯、調(diào)試、預(yù)覽等功能,是開發(fā)微信小程序不可或缺的利器。
二、基礎(chǔ)概念
了解小程序的基本結(jié)構(gòu)至關(guān)重要。一個小程序由多個頁面組成,每個頁面由四個文件構(gòu)成:.wxml
(頁面結(jié)構(gòu))、.wxss
(頁面樣式)、.js
(頁面邏輯)和.json
(頁面配置)。熟悉這些文件的作用和編寫規(guī)范,是進(jìn)行小程序開發(fā)的基礎(chǔ)。
三、API與組件
微信小程序提供了豐富的API接口和組件庫,涵蓋了網(wǎng)絡(luò)請求、數(shù)據(jù)存儲、設(shè)備信息獲取、媒體操作等多個方面。熟練掌握這些API和組件的使用方法,可以極大提升小程序的功能性和用戶體驗。
四、真機(jī)調(diào)試
在開發(fā)過程中,頻繁地在真實設(shè)備上進(jìn)行調(diào)試是十分必要的。微信開發(fā)者工具支持將小程序代碼直接上傳至微信服務(wù)器,然后通過手機(jī)微信掃描二維碼的方式,在真機(jī)上查看和測試小程序的實際效果。
五、發(fā)布上線
當(dāng)小程序開發(fā)完成并通過內(nèi)部測試后,接下來就是提交審核和發(fā)布的過程。開發(fā)者需要登錄微信公眾平臺,按照指引提交小程序的相關(guān)資料和版本信息,等待微信團(tuán)隊的審核。審核通過后,即可正式上線,供用戶使用。
總之,微信小程序開發(fā)不僅要求開發(fā)者具備一定的前端技術(shù)基礎(chǔ),還需要對微信生態(tài)有深入的理解。通過官方教程的學(xué)習(xí)和實踐,開發(fā)者可以逐步掌握小程序開發(fā)的核心技能,創(chuàng)造出既美觀又實用的應(yīng)用程序,為用戶提供更加便捷的服務(wù)體驗。